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Shotton to Sunderland start from as little as £31.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Shotton to Sunderland are available for £104.20 one way, or £168.00 return

Station Facilities and Services

For those looking to purchase tickets at Shotton station, there is a ticket office that operates Monday to Friday from 07:30 to 12:30 and on Saturdays from 08:45 to 13:45. Although it remains closed on Sundays, ticket machines are available and provide touchscreen interfaces, accepting major debit and credit cards. Unfortunately, they do not accept cash, so be sure to have your card handy if you're buying tickets at the station.

Step-free access is partially available, but there's no wheelchair access to Platform 1 on the Shotton level. Meanwhile, Platform 2, which heads towards Holyhead, can be accessed from the car park at Alexandra Street's end. If fully accessible amenities are a necessity, travelers should consider using nearby Hawarden Bridge station. The station does not currently offer personal distress facilities such as accessible toilets, nor does it have ATMs, shopping outlets, or refreshment facilities.

Transport Connections

Connections from Shotton station are straightforward and cater to various travel needs. A well-placed taxi office is available right outside the station, which is particularly useful for those in need of quick onward travel. If your journey involves a bus, local bus stops are conveniently located on Chester Road West, adjacent to the station. For those instances when rail services are disrupted, rail replacement services operate from bus stops near the Rivertown URC Church. While there are no on-site cycle hire facilities, bike storage is generous, featuring both stands and lock-ups sheltered and monitored by CCTV.

Facilities at Sunderland Station

The station is well-equipped with a ticket office open from early morning until the evening, providing flexibility for purchasing and collecting tickets. Ticket machines are available around the clock, and the accessible machines make it easy for all travelers to get their tickets effortlessly. A smartcard facility is also on hand for those frequent travelers looking to streamline their journey.

Travelers who may need assistance will find help readily available at Sunderland Station. Staff are on duty to offer aid throughout most of the day and night, with facilities such as an induction loop in place to aid those with hearing impairments. Although there is no CCTV, customer help is accessible via contact numbers for added support.

Accessibility and Amenities

Sunderland Train Station boasts comprehensive accessibility with step-free access to all areas, including lifts to each platform. This makes it a Category A station, suitable for all passengers, particularly those with mobility challenges. With waiting rooms not in service, comfort is still maintained with ample seating available throughout. Although there are no accessible toilets, baby-changing facilities are provided to cater to those traveling with young children.

While you'll find essential facilities like refreshment options, the absence of shops means planning ahead is wise. There are no ATM or currency exchange services, so grabbing cash beforehand would be beneficial. Wi-Fi isn't available at the station, ensuring you stay off the grid while traveling or stay entertained through other offline means.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Making onward journeys from Sunderland Station is seamless with its diverse transport links. The station is conveniently located near a taxi rank, making it easy to hail a cab for quick city escapes. For a more economical option, there are several local bus services to choose from. Additionally, the nearby Tyne and Wear Metro station further expands connectivity across the region.
